## Further Reading

Before modifying the Hollowgrange retention sweeper, read the design notes carefully — deletion is irreversible, and the sweeper's dry-run mode has subtle caveats around tombstoned records. The architecture overview, policy schema reference, and audit-log expectations for contractors are all consolidated on the internal documentation page linked below.

dashboard of tajof-kaweg = https://confluence.tolvaqlabs.internal/display/projects/display/display

Orders table soft deletes — decision made. Adding deleted_at column, no hard deletes from app code. Backfill script runs Thursday night on Pellwick staging first. All queries in the Cartwheel service must filter deleted rows; shared scope lands this sprint. Reporting jobs need audit — some aggregate over deleted orders today. Retention: purge soft-deleted rows after 180 days via nightly job. Open question: cascade to order_items, parked for next sync. Migration sign-off goes to the owner below.

account owner for bawip-tahag: Raleth Quenok

## Authentication

The Sproutly scheduler talks to the internal Drizzleplan service to fetch per-bed watering windows. All requests require a bearer key passed in the standard auth header; the key is scoped to read schedules and post completion events only. Keys rotate every 90 days via the Potting automation job. For running the scheduler against the staging Drizzleplan instance, use the key below.

service key, fawip-bajef: kto11_Qt5wZK9vdNC